    Got great service from Patric. She checked on me periodically and kept my drink filled. The food was amazing. I got the pick 3, and I had 2 eggs, 2 pancakes and 2 pieces of flat Italian sausage patties. The sausage was so good (it did cost $2 extra, but worth every penny). Large servings. The atmosphere was casual. There were lots of bear photos and murals in the restaurant and even and bear toys in the lobby near the cash register. Reminded me of Colorado.

    Black Bear is one of my favorite breakfast places in the Spring area. This was my first time visiting this specific location and I enjoyed it more than the location in Shenandoah. This one is a little smaller, but the environment feels cozier. I really appreciate all the effort that went into creating the theme of this restaurant. We came in a little later on Saturday morning and were seated right away. That's usually a little bit of a red flag during a restaurant's busiest time, but we had no issues with our visit! First of all, our waitress was phenomenal. She was busy, but never missed a beat. She was so nice! I didn't catch her name, but the server name on our receipt was Patricka, so I hope that's right! If so, I highly recommend requesting to sit in her section. One of the things I love most about Black Bear is that they don't skimp on the iced coffee. Most places you go for breakfast, you get unlimited refills on hot black coffee, but if you order iced coffee you're out of luck. It's usually served in pretty small glass. Black Bear makes your iced coffees in a glass big enough that you won't miss not getting refills. I had the cinnamon vanilla cold brew from their seasonal menu and it was really good. I also really like their sweet cream waffle. They even make it with a bear claw imprinted on the center. I've never eaten dinner here, but breakfast is always good.
